Problems solved by technology

[0003] When the current automobile exhaust treatment device is installed, most of them are fixedly connected to the automobile exhaust pipe through the flange, and then the two are relatively fixed by fixing bolts and nuts. However, when the car is running, the body will vibrate violently, causing the fixing bolts to It will loosen under the action of constant vibration, which may cause the exhaust gas treatment device to fall off, and the untreated exhaust gas will leak into the atmosphere and pollute the atmosphere
It is not conducive to environmental protection, and the current air flow in the exhaust gas treatment device is mostly realized by extrusion, resulting in the treated gas also staying in the treatment device, occupying the filter space of the treatment device, and affecting the treatment efficiency of the exhaust gas

Abstract

An anti-loosening exhaust gas treatment device based on the principle of magnetoelectricity, which relates to the technical field of air pollution control, includes a housing, the middle of the housing is fixedly connected with a three-phase catalytic converter, and the inner walls at both ends of the housing are fixedly connected with two For mutually symmetrical magnetic rings, electromagnets are fixedly connected to the inner walls of both ends of the casing, and evenly distributed springs are fixedly connected to the outer sides of the casing. The anti-loose exhaust gas treatment device based on the principle of magnetoelectricity is used in conjunction with the limit block and the limit slot. When in use, the exhaust gas will drive the closed coil in the impeller to continuously cut the magnetic induction line of the magnetic ring, which is generated according to the principle of magnetoelectricity. Current, and the current is sent to the electromagnet to make the electromagnet generate magnetism, and then according to the principle of repulsion of the same sex, the limit block moves to the outside and engages with the limit slot, thereby achieving the effect of preventing the fixing screw from loosening. Effectively prevent exhaust gas leakage and ensure the fastening of the exhaust processor.
